Páginas filhas
  • DT Parâmetro para o usuário se ausentar do sistema

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Tempo aproximado para leitura: 08 min



Aviso
titleProcesso descontinuado

Este processo foi descontinuado a partir da versão 5.1.2305.0000

01. DADOS GERAIS

Linha de Produto:Virtual Age
Segmento:Moda
Módulo:Virtual.PDV
Função:Possibilidade do usuário se ausentar do sistema.
Ticket:#3667031
Requisito/Story/Issue (informe o requisito relacionado) :DVAVAR-1212


02. SITUAÇÃO/REQUISITO

Ter uma opção no qual o usuário pode ficar "ausente" no virtualPDV, ou seja, ninguém pode usar o terminal, a não ser o próprio usuário que se "ausentou", e/ ou usuário gerente, qualquer outro usuário não pode fazer a liberação.

03. SOLUÇÃO

Foi criado um parâmetro que quando ativo, possibilitará o usuário bloquear o sistema para utilização de usuários terceiros, exceto com autenticação da gerência e ou do próprio usuário.

    • Não é possível se ausentar com o caixa fechado, ou aberto com data retroativa.
    • Se um usuário terceiro precisar utilizar o terminal, a gerência ou o usuário ausente deverá logar no sistema e sair sem se ausentar.
    • Se um gerente liberar um terminal ausente, será gravado um log.
    • Quando o usuário se ausenta, o terminal permanece bloqueado até que seja liberado. Ex: O usuário se ausentou hoje, no dia seguinte o terminal ainda estará bloqueado.
    • Uma vez logado, se o caixa estiver com data retroativa, não será possível se ausentar até realizar o encerramento diário.


Totvs custom tabs box
tabsPasso 01, Passo 02, Passo 03, Passo 04, Passo 05
idspasso1,passo2,passo3,passo4,passo5
Totvs custom tabs box items
defaultyes
referenciapasso1

Na tela de Configuração de Parâmetros na aba Usuário, configurar como Valida o parâmetro Login Usuário Ausente.

Totvs custom tabs box items
defaultno
referenciapasso3passo2

Na tela inicial do sistema, ao clicar no botão Sair ou pressionar Esc, o sistema irá perguntar ao usuário "Deseja se ausentar?", possibilitando 2 escolhas:

  1. Sim: O terminal será bloqueado, para que usuários terceiros não possam acessar o sistema, exceto com autenticação da gerência e ou do usuário ausente.
  2. Não: O terminal permanecerá livre para qualquer usuário acessar.

Totvs custom tabs box items
defaultno
referenciapasso4passo3

Quando o terminal estiver ausente o layout do login ficará com uma coloração alaranjado.

Totvs custom tabs box items
defaultno
referenciapasso5passo4

Se qualquer usuário, diferente do usuário ausente tentar logar no sistema, a mensagem abaixo será apresentada:

Totvs custom tabs box items
defaultno
referenciapasso6passo5

Se o terminal for liberado pelo gerente, a mensagem abaixo será apresentada:


Templatedocumentos



HTML
<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}
</style>